Offering DNA testing for legal and non-legal purposes
Legal DNA test – when needing a DNA test for paternity, child custody or any court ordered purpose a legal DNA test must be performed at a testing center, the child/children and the alleged father will be scheduled to go to one of our many testing centers nationwide with appropriate documentation, identification, and the test will be performed by a qualified DNA test collector who will then send the specimen to a certified AABB laboratory. Results will be available in approximately 10 days after the laboratory receives the specimen.
Non-legal DNA test -this test is performed for informational purposes only, a DNA certified test kit will be sent to the purchaser via regular mail or overnight delivery. The kit will include clear instructions of how to perform the DNA test, the purchaser will utilize an oral fluid swab for the child/children and alleged father. upon completion the specimen will be placed in a prepaid delivery envelope and sent to our AABB certified laboratory. Results will be available in approximately 10 days after the specimens are received at the laboratory. Please remember the non-legal DNA test cannot be used in a court of law or for any legal purpose.

Establishing parentage for custody/support.
When it comes to deciding custody or support, DNA testing is essential in confirming parentage. These court-admissible results provide indisputable proof of biological lineage, aiding judges in creating fair parental and financial arrangements.
Confirming familial relationships.
DNA tests are pivotal in validating familial relationships such as those among siblings and other close relatives. These accurate genetic assessments assist in resolving inheritance matters and fortifying family ties with undeniable biological evidence.
Immigration cases requiring proof of biological relationships.
DNA testing is a reliable method for confirming biological ties in immigration scenarios. These legal tests afford definitive evidence recognized by immigration bodies, sketching a clear path to quicker family reunification.
Adoption cases or identifying unknown biological relatives.
In adoption searches, DNA testing uncovers unknown biological connections, providing adoptees with vital insights into their genetic lineage, which can facilitate emotional healing and connection to family health backgrounds.
